  • NVIDIA Launches Cosmos 3 Edge: NVIDIA released a 4 billion parameter open frontier world model optimized for on-device operations across edge infrastructure like DGX Spark and Jetson. Equipped with a 2 billion parameter Nemotron reasoner, it is designed to help autonomous vehicles and smart infrastructure analyze live video and predict user intent. (Source)
  • Baidu Drops Game-Changing OCR Model: Baidu open-sourced Unlimited-OCR, a 3 billion parameter model that processes entire 40-page documents in a single shot while running locally for free. Using a 32K context window, the model preserves complex reading orders, tables, and formulas across pages, achieving 93% accuracy on benchmarks and outputting structured Markdown. (Source)

The Illusion of the AI “Floor” (Source) François Chollet delivers a sharp critique of AI industry marketing, explaining that artificial competence remains highly “spiky” rather than broadly generalized. He argues that companies exploit human anthropomorphism; because human expertise in one area usually implies a baseline general ability to acquire skills, we incorrectly assume a machine’s superhuman spike in a narrow domain guarantees a high capability floor across the board. In reality, these models can exhibit brilliance in specialized domains while remaining largely useless in others.

How Latent Actions Are Scaling Robotics (Source) This thread highlights a major paradigm shift in robotics training away from expensive, unscalable action labels derived from heavy teleoperation. By utilizing latent codes that simply explain the state changes between two video frames—a concept demonstrated cleanly by DeepMind’s Genie—researchers can train agents without seeing explicit ground-truth action labels. A new FAIR paper is now attempting to generalize this latent action learning across noisy, unlabeled internet video, which could unlock a nearly infinite source of training data for physical AI systems.

The Risks of Banning Open Chinese Models (Source) Addressing the policy rumors of the US curbing access to advanced models like Kimi, Aaron Levie outlines why such a move would be economically self-destructive. He warns that extreme bans would asymmetrically disadvantage American developers while the rest of the globe continues leveraging access to both closed and open frameworks. Shutting out these models would artificially restrict US options for driving down compute costs, fine-tuning infrastructure for specific industries, and maintaining the competitive market pressure needed to advance the research frontier.
